Overview

Matthew Raymond is a Physiatrist in Southington, Connecticut. Dr. Raymond is highly rated in 2 conditions, according to our data. His top areas of expertise are Cerebral Palsy, Hemiplegia, Primary Lateral Sclerosis, and Paraplegia.

His clinical research consists of co-authoring 1 peer reviewed article. MediFind looks at clinical research from the past 15 years.
